The intellectual publishing landscape is largely shaped by the so-called Big Five publishers. These entities, namely Elsevier, Springer Nature, Wiley, Taylor & Francis, and Wolters Kluwer, exert a significant influence on academic output. While they facilitate crucial platforms for disseminating knowledge, their dominance has sparked discussion regarding affordability in academic publishing. Critics argue that the high costs associated with accessing scholarly works create barriers to research, particularly for researchers in developing countries.
The Big Five's business models often prioritize revenue generation over the shareability of knowledge. This has led to calls for reform in the publishing industry, with advocates promoting free access as a solution to ensure that research findings are universally disseminated.

Navigating the New Landscape: Open Access vs. Traditional Scholarship
The scholarly publishing landscape is shifting at a rapid pace, with open access (OA) models increasingly challenging the dominance of traditional subscription-based models. Advocates for OA champion its potential to increase accessibility knowledge by making research freely obtainable to all. This shift has ignited discussion within the academic community, with some embracing OA as a vital step toward greater transparency and interaction, while others express concerns about its influence on scholarly quality and the financial sustainability of journals.
- Ultimately, the future of scholarship likely lies in a hybrid model that blends the strengths of both OA and traditional models. This will require ongoing dialogue among stakeholders, including researchers, publishers, funding agencies, and academic organizations, to create sustainable solutions that emphasize the free flow of knowledge while ensuring the long-term viability of scholarly publishing.
